About this course

With the growing demand for effective and sustainable philanthropic efforts, there is an increasing need for NGO leaders who possess the ability to create and implement successful fundraising strategies, build strong partnerships, and communicate their organization's mission effectively. This course equips learners with these essential skills, enabling them to advance their careers in the philanthropic sector and maximize their organization's social impact. By completing this course, learners will not only develop a deep understanding of the philanthropic landscape, but they will also gain the practical skills needed to drive successful fundraising campaigns, build strategic partnerships, and communicate the impact of their organization's work to key stakeholders. As a result, this course is an invaluable resource for NGO leaders seeking to advance their careers and make a meaningful difference in the world.
